To the extent that the profit margins of Bitcoin mining operations are not high, Bitcoin mining companies or other participants in the Bitcoin industry are more likely to immediately sell Bitcoins in the market, thereby constraining growth of the price of Bitcoin that could adversely impact us.
Over the years, Bitcoin mining operations have shifted from individual users mining with computer processors, graphics processing units and first-generation ASIC servers to larger enterprises with newer, more "professionalized" sources of processing power which has been predominantly added by "professionalized" mining operations and resulting demand for more professionalized and powerful miners having faster hash rates. These professionalized mining operations may use proprietary hardware or sophisticated ASIC machines acquired from ASIC manufacturers. Acquiring this specialized hardware at scale requires the investment of significant up-front capital, and mine operators incur significant expenses related to the operation of this hardware at scale, such as the leasing of operating space, which is often done in data centers or warehousing facilities, obtaining and paying for an electricity supply to run the miners and employing technicians to operate the mining facilities.
As a result, these professionalized mining operations are of a greater scale than prior miners and have more defined and regular expenses and liabilities. Because these regular expenses and liabilities require professionalized mining operations to maintain profit margins on the sale of Bitcoin, to the extent the price of Bitcoin declines and such profit margin is constrained, such mining companies are incentivized to sell Bitcoin earned from mining operations more rapidly than individual mining companies who in past years were more likely to hold newly mined Bitcoin for longer periods. The immediate selling of newly mined Bitcoin greatly increases the trading volume of Bitcoin, creating downward pressure on the market price of Bitcoin rewards.
The extent to which the value of Bitcoin mined by a professionalized mining operation exceeds the allocable capital and operating costs determines the profit margin of such an operation. A professionalized mining operation may be more likely to sell a higher percentage of its newly mined Bitcoin rapidly if it is operating at a low profit margin and it may partially or completely cease operations if its profit margin is negative. In a low profit margin environment, a higher percentage could be sold more rapidly, thereby potentially depressing Bitcoin prices. Lower Bitcoin prices could result in further tightening of profit margins for professionalized mining operations creating a network effect that may further reduce the price of Bitcoin until mining operations with higher operating costs become unprofitable forcing them to reduce mining power or cease mining operations temporarily.

Bitcoin is subject to halving, meaning that the Bitcoin rewarded for solving a block will be reduced in the future and its value may not commensurately adjust to compensate us for such reductions, and the overall supply of Bitcoin is finite.
Bitcoin is subject to "halving," which is the process by which the Bitcoin
reward for solving a block is reduced by 50% every 210,000 blocks that are
solved. This means that the amount of Bitcoin we (or any other miner) are
rewarded for solving a block in the blockchain is permanently cut in half. For
example, the latest halving having occurred in
Further, due to the halving process, unless the underlying code of the Bitcoin blockchain is altered (which may be unlikely or difficult given its decentralized nature), the supply of Bitcoin is finite. Once 21 million Bitcoin have been generated by virtue of solving blocks in the blockchain, the network will stop producing more. Currently, there are approximately 19 million Bitcoin in circulation representing about 90% of the total supply of Bitcoin under the current source code. For the foregoing reasons, the halving feature exposes us to inherent uncertainty and reliance upon the historically volatile price of Bitcoin, rendering an investment in us particularly speculative, especially in the long-term. If the price of Bitcoin does not significantly increase in value, your investment could become worthless.

Bitcoin has forked multiple times and additional forks may occur in the future which may affect the value of Bitcoin held or mined by the Company.
To the extent that a significant majority of users and mining companies on a
cryptocurrency network install software that changes the cryptocurrency network
or properties of a cryptocurrency, including the irreversibility of transactions
and limitations on the mining of new cryptocurrency, the cryptocurrency network
would be subject to new protocols and software. However, if less than a
significant majority of users and mining companies on the cryptocurrency network
consent to the proposed modification, and the modification is not compatible
with the software prior to its modification, the consequence would be what is
known as a "fork" of the network, with one prong running the
pre-modified software and the other running the modified software. The effect of
such a fork would be the existence of two versions of the cryptocurrency running
in parallel yet lacking interchangeability and necessitating
exchange-type transaction to convert currencies between the two forks.
Additionally, it may be unclear following a fork which fork represents the
original cryptocurrency and which is the new cryptocurrency. Different metrics
adopted by industry participants to determine which is the original asset
include: referring to the wishes of the core developers of a cryptocurrency,
blockchains with the greatest amount of hashing power contributed by miners or
validators; or blockchains with the longest chain. A fork in the network of a
particular cryptocurrency could adversely affect an investment in our securities

Because of the reliance on third-party mining pool service providers for our mining, its operations may have a negative impact on the Company's results of operations.
The third party hosting company will arrange our cryptocurrency mining operations using a mining pool, in which multiple cryptocurrency mining operators agree to join together and if any of them are rewarded Bitcoin for mining a block on the blockchain, the pool participants receive a portion of such reward based on the computing power contributed to mining that block. Under this arrangement, we would receive Bitcoin mining rewards from our mining activity through a third-party mining pool operator. Mining pools allow miners to combine their processing power, increasing their chances of solving a block and getting paid by the network. Should the pool operator's system suffer downtime due to a cyber-attack, software malfunction or other similar issues, it will negatively impact our ability to mine and receive revenue. Furthermore, we are dependent on the accuracy of the mining pool operator's record keeping to accurately record the total processing power provided to the pool for a given Bitcoin mining application in order to assess the proportion of that total processing power we provided. We would have limited means of recourse against the mining pool operator if we determine the proportion of the reward paid out to us by the mining pool operator is incorrect, other than leaving the pool. If we are unable to consistently obtain accurate proportionate rewards from our mining pool operators, we may experience reduced reward for our efforts, which would have an adverse effect on our business and operations.

We will rely on one or more third parties for depositing, storing and withdrawing the cryptocurrency we mine, which could result in loss of assets, disputes and other liabilities or risks which could adversely impact our business.
We currently use a BlockFi digital wallet to store the Bitcoin we mine, although we may change to another digital wallet provider or use multiple providers at any time. In order to own, transfer and use Bitcoin on the blockchain network, we must have a private and public key pair associated with a network address, commonly referred to as a "wallet". Each wallet is associated with a unique "public key" and "private key" pair, each of which is a string of alphanumerical characters. To deposit Bitcoin into our digital wallet, we must "sign" a transaction that consists of the private key of the wallet from where the Bitcoin is being transferred, the public key of a wallet that BlockFi or its custodian controls and provides to us, and broadcast the deposit transaction onto the underlying blockchain network. Similarly, to withdraw Bitcoin from our account, we must provide BlockFi or its custodian with the public key of the wallet that the Bitcoin are to be transferred to, and BlockFi or its custodian then "signs" a transaction authorizing the transfer. In addition, some cryptocurrency networks require additional information to be provided in connection with any transfer of cryptocurrency such as Bitcoin. A number of errors or other adverse events can occur in the process of depositing, storing or withdrawing Bitcoin into or from BlockFi, such as typos, mistakes, or the failure to include the information required by the blockchain network. For instance, a user may incorrectly enter our wallet's public key or the desired recipient's public key when depositing and withdrawing Bitcoin. Additionally, our reliance on third parties such as BlockFi and the maintenance of keys to access and utilize our digital wallet will expose us to enhanced cybersecurity risks from unauthorized third parties deploying illicit activities such as hacking, phishing and social engineering, notwithstanding the security systems and safeguards employed by us and others. Cyberattacks upon systems across a variety of industries, including the cryptocurrency industry, are increasing in frequency, persistence, and sophistication, and, in many cases, are being conducted by sophisticated, well-funded, and organized groups and individuals. For example, attacks may be designed to deceive employees and service providers into releasing control of the systems on which we depend to a hacker, while others may aim to introduce computer viruses or malware into such systems with a view to stealing confidential or proprietary data. These attacks may occur on our digital wallet or the systems of our third-party service providers or partners, which could result in asset losses and other adverse consequences. Alternatively, we may inadvertently transfer Bitcoin to a wallet address that we do not own, control or hold the private keys to. In addition, a Bitcoin wallet address can only be used to send and receive Bitcoin, and if the Bitcoin is inadvertently sent to an Ethereum or other cryptocurrency wallet address, or if any of the foregoing errors occur, all of the Bitcoin will be permanently and irretrievably lost with no means of recovery. Such incidents could result in asset loss or disputes, any of which could materially adversely affect our business.

If a malicious actor or botnet obtains control of more than 50% of the processing power on a cryptocurrency network, such actor or botnet could manipulate blockchains to adversely affect us, which would adversely affect an investment in us or our ability to operate.
If a malicious actor or botnet (a volunteer or hacked collection of computers controlled by networked software coordinating the actions of the computers) obtains a majority of the processing power dedicated to mining a cryptocurrency, it may be able to alter blockchains on which transactions of cryptocurrency reside and rely by constructing fraudulent blocks or preventing certain transactions from completing in a timely manner, or at all. The malicious actor or botnet could control, exclude or modify the ordering of transactions, though it could not generate new units or transactions using such control. The malicious actor could "double-spend" its own cryptocurrency (i.e., spend the same Bitcoin in more than one transaction) and prevent the confirmation of other users' transactions for as long as it maintained control. To the extent that such malicious actor or botnet does not yield its control of the processing power on the network or the cryptocurrency community does not reject the fraudulent blocks as malicious, reversing any changes made to blockchains may not be possible. The foregoing description is not the only means by which the entirety of blockchains or cryptocurrencies may be compromised but is only an example.
Although there are no known reports of malicious activity or control of blockchains achieved through controlling over 50% of the processing power on the network, it is believed that certain mining pools may have exceeded the 50% threshold in Bitcoin. The possible crossing of the 50% threshold indicates a greater risk that a single mining pool could exert authority over the validation of Bitcoin transactions. To the extent that the Bitcoin community, and the administrators of mining pools, do not act to ensure greater decentralization of Bitcoin mining processing power, the feasibility of a botnet or malicious actor obtaining control of the blockchain's processing power will increase, because such botnet or malicious actor could more readily infiltrate and seize control over the blockchain by compromising a single mining pool, if the mining pool compromises more than 50% of the mining power on the blockchain, than it could if the mining pool had a smaller share of the blockchain's total hashing power. Conversely, if the blockchain remains decentralized it is inherently more difficult for the botnet or malicious actor to aggregate enough processing power to gain control of the blockchain. If this were to occur, the public may lose confidence in the Bitcoin blockchain, and blockchain technology more generally. This would likely have a material and adverse effect on the price of Bitcoin, which could have a material adverse effect on our business, financial results and operations, and harm investors.
If the Bitcoin rewards for solving blocks are not sufficiently high, miners may not have adequate incentive to continue mining and may cease mining operations, which may make the blockchains they support with their mining activity less stable.
As the number of cryptocurrency rewards awarded for solving a block in a blockchain decreases, the relative cost of producing a single cryptocurrency will also increase, unless there is a corresponding increase in demand for that cryptocurrency. Even relatively stable demand may not be sufficient to support the costs of mining, because as new miners begin working to solve blocks, the relative amount of energy expended to obtain a cryptocurrency award will tend to increase. This increased energy directly relates to an increased cost of mining, which means an increased cost of obtaining a cryptocurrency award. This increased cost, if not met with a corresponding increase in the market price for the cryptocurrency resulting from increased scarcity and demand, may lead miners, such as us, to conclude they do not have an adequate incentive to continue mining and, therefore, may cease their mining operations. This could in turn reduce the sustainability of the Bitcoin blockchain, which is dependent upon continued mining to solve the block's algorithms and process transactions in Bitcoin. If this were to occur, your investment in us could become worthless.

We have been a shell company as defined under Rule 405 of the Securities Act of 1933 ("Securities Act"). As securities issued by a former shell company, the securities issued by us can only be resold pursuant to an effective registration statement and not by utilizing the provisions of Rule 144 until certain conditions are met, including that: (i) we are subject to the reporting requirements of Section 13 or 15(d) of the Exchange Act, (ii) we have filed all required reports under the Exchange Act of the preceding 12 months and (iii) one year has elapsed since we filed "Form 10" information (e.g. audited financial statements, management information and compensation, shareholder information, etc.).
Thus, a shareholder of ours will not be able to sell its shares until such time as a registration statement for those shares is filed or we become a reporting company, we have remained current on our Exchange Act filings for 12 months and we have filed the information as would be required by a "Form 10" filing.
